linuxdd命令u盘
-
在Linux系统中,可以使用dd命令对U盘进行操作。dd命令是一个非常强大的命令行工具,可以用来复制文件、转换格式、创建镜像等操作。
要使用dd命令对U盘进行操作,首先需要确认U盘在系统中被识别为哪个设备。可以通过命令`lsblk`来查看系统中的设备列表,找到U盘所对应的设备名,通常是类似于`/dev/sdb`这样的形式。
下面是一些常用的dd命令操作示例,假设U盘被识别为`/dev/sdb`:
1. 复制文件到U盘:
“`shell
dd if=/path/to/file of=/dev/sdb
“`
将`/path/to/file`替换为要复制到U盘的文件路径。2. 从U盘创建镜像文件:
“`shell
dd if=/dev/sdb of=/path/to/image.img
“`
将`/path/to/image.img`替换为要保存镜像文件的路径。3. 将U盘的内容完整地复制到另一个U盘:
“`shell
dd if=/dev/sdb of=/dev/sdc
“`
将`/dev/sdc`替换为目标U盘的设备名。请注意,这会完全覆盖目标U盘的所有数据,请谨慎操作。4. 清除U盘上的所有数据:
“`shell
dd if=/dev/zero of=/dev/sdb bs=4M
“`
这会将U盘上的所有数据覆盖为0,相当于完全擦除U盘的内容。请注意,在执行dd命令时要确保设备名的正确性,避免对错误设备进行操作,以免造成不可逆的数据损坏。另外,dd命令非常强大,请谨慎使用,并在操作之前备份重要数据。
2年前 -
在Linux中,可以使用dd命令来对U盘进行操作,包括创建U盘的镜像、写入镜像到U盘、备份U盘的数据等。下面是使用dd命令对U盘进行操作的一些常见用法:
1. 创建U盘镜像:
“`
dd if=/dev/sdb of=/path/to/image.img
“`
这里`/dev/sdb`是U盘设备的路径,`/path/to/image.img`是要保存镜像的路径。这个命令会将整个U盘的内容复制到指定的镜像文件中。2. 将镜像写入U盘:
“`
dd if=/path/to/image.img of=/dev/sdb
“`
这里`/path/to/image.img`是要写入的镜像文件,`/dev/sdb`是U盘设备的路径。这个命令会将镜像文件写入U盘,覆盖U盘的所有数据。3. 备份U盘数据:
“`
dd if=/dev/sdb of=/path/to/backup.img
“`
这个命令会将U盘的内容复制到指定的备份文件中,`/dev/sdb`是U盘设备的路径,`/path/to/backup.img`是要保存备份的路径。4. 清除U盘数据:
“`
dd if=/dev/zero of=/dev/sdb bs=4M
“`
这个命令会将U盘的所有数据填充为0,`/dev/sdb`是U盘设备的路径。5. 检查U盘的坏道:
“`
badblocks -n /dev/sdb
“`
这个命令会扫描U盘,并检查是否存在坏道,`/dev/sdb`是U盘设备的路径。2年前 -
在Linux系统中,dd命令是一个非常强大的工具,可以用来复制和转换文件。在这里,我们将使用dd命令来将一个U盘复制到另一个U盘。
以下是使用dd命令在Linux系统中复制U盘的步骤:
1. 确认U盘设备名称:在终端中输入以下命令来查看已连接的U盘设备名称:
“`shell
lsblk
“`
这将显示与系统相连的所有设备,找到U盘设备名称(通常为sdx,其中x为小写字母,例如sdb)。2. 卸载U盘:在复制过程之前,需要确保U盘未被系统挂载。通过以下命令来卸载U盘:
“`shell
sudo umount /dev/sdx
“`
将“/dev/sdx”替换为实际的U盘设备名称。3. 复制U盘:使用以下命令来复制U盘:
“`shell
sudo dd if=/dev/sdx of=/dev/sdy bs=4M
“`
将“/dev/sdx”替换为源U盘的设备名称,将“/dev/sdy”替换为目标U盘的设备名称。在这个命令中,if选项指定输入文件,也就是源U盘;of选项指定输出文件,也就是目标U盘;bs选项指定块大小,这里我们指定为4M。
请注意,使用dd命令时需要非常小心,因为它是一个非常强大的工具,错误的使用可能导致数据丢失。
4. 等待复制完成:复制过程可能需要一些时间,取决于U盘的大小和计算机的性能。请耐心等待,直到命令完成。
5. 完成复制:当dd命令完成后,即可断开目标U盘并将其插入另一台电脑进行使用。它应该是源U盘的完全副本。
通过使用dd命令,我们可以在Linux系统中轻松地复制U盘。但请务必谨慎使用,并确保在复制之前备份重要的数据。
2年前